Not to mention the deafening sounds created by the hundreds of vuvuzela enthusiasts.
Many food stalls catered for the hungry crowd, but if you wanted to quench your thirst, the choice was limited to a few soft drinks sold by vendors. The promised beer tent never opened as the organisers could not obtain a wine and malt licence in time. But in spite of the enforced probation, spirits ran high and fun was had by young and old.
Here are some images from the day, dubbed by many as a very successful ‘dry run’.
